Unable to select /apps/koken/ as directory for rSync (only share allowed)
I'm trying to create a "geo-redundant" setup between two Koken CMS installations on two RNs. (See also: http://help.koken.me/customer/en/portal/questions/16197007-geo-redundant-koken-setup.) Currentl...

I don't know anything about Koken, but you could try creating a Koken share, and copying all the data from /data/,apps//koken to it (preserving permissions, etc). Then delete the contents of /apps/koken and create a softlink to the share. If you do that in both systems, normal rsync backup will work.
Another approach would be to create a cron job to copy /apps/Koken to a share (and then back up the share). The cron job approach has the benefit that you can shut down the service, before you update the share (restarting it afterwords). Though the backup snapshot should give you a coherent copy w/o needing to do that.
Either way, you won't get two-way sync - but you can get the slave to mirror the master.

Know issues on this setup: The Koken admin pages on the slave doesn't show the libraries, essays and other content.
The live site however is now fully synced by means of SQL replication, a symbolic link (see above) and rsync of /data/koken/web.
